French swimmer Laure Manaudou sacked by Italian club

laure French swimmer and world and Olympic 400m freestyle champion Laure Manaudou has been sacked by her Italian club, it has been reported.

The club hasn't revealed why they dismissed Laure Manaudou after last weekend's Paris Open meet.

French newspaper L'Equipe had said her French coach Paolo Penso had criticised her performance and commitment and the report also added that her brother would now coach Laure Manaudou.

Italian club president Marco Durante said in a statement: "There's one chance in a million for Laure to understand and come back."

Laure Manaudou, 20, whose boyfriend is an Italian swimmer, had already parted company with French coach Philippe Lucas in May when she had moved to Turin.

Laure Manaudou claimed the 400m freestyle at the 2004 Olympics and went on to win five medals at the World Championships in Melbourne earlier this year, including gold in the 200m and 400m freestyle.
